About London
London serves as the administrative center of United Kingdom.
London is the biggest metropolitan area in United Kingdom.
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 71%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 83%.
London is home of the academic institute University College London. The biggest sports facility in London is Wembley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is St Thomas'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Richmond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the British Museum, which showcases London’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it British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Heathrow Airport by Heathrow Express, London Underground and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around London with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Underground,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are King's Cross St. Pancras, Victoria Coach Station and London Waterloo.
In London,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Oyster card, Contactless payment and Cash.
About Dortmund
Summers have an average temperature of 18 °C, with humidity levels of about 73%. Winters bring an average temperature of 2 °C, with humidity levels of about 82%.
Dortmund is home of the academic institute Technical University of Dortmund. The biggest sports facility in Dortmund is Signal Iduna Park,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Klinikum Dortmund.
Nature lovers can unwind at Westfalenpark,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the German Football Museum, which showcases Dortmund’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Stadt- und Landesbibliothek Dortmund for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Dortmund Airport by Bus, Taxi and Train.
There are several ways to get around Dortmund with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Train, Bus and Subway.
